jut

[empty]
Intransitive VerbTransitive Verb
past: juttedpp: jutteding: jutting

Meanings

Intransitive Verb[empty]
[~ out][~ forward]

To extend or project outward beyond the main body or surface of something.

The rocky cliff juts out over the crashing waves.

Transitive Verb[empty]
[~ something]

To cause something to project or stick out from a surface.

Phrasal Verbs

jut out

to extend or project outward from a surface
